About

Louise F. Brown is an estate planning attorney with over 53 years of legal experience, practicing at Law Offices of Louise F. Brown in Sharon, CT. He earned a degree from Harvard University A.B. in 1965, a M.A. from Columbia University in 1966, and a J.D. from Boston University School of Law in 1972. He has been admitted to the Connecticut Bar since 1973. His practice encompasses estate planning, lawsuits and disputes, probate, and real estate,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
